Mesothelioma can result from asbestos exposure, but also by exposure to other toxic substances or one exposure. Asbestos is a known cause of cancer and illnesses such as lung cancer, asbestosis, and mesothelioma.

Class action lawsuits aren't usually part of mesothelioma litigation. The Supreme Court has ruled that it is unfair to include asbestos patients who are currently and in the future in one class, as their histories of exposure and illnesses are not comparable enough to be treated as part of the same class. This, along with other rulings against class certification have led to mesothelioma cases being mostly tried in mass torts or separately filed lawsuits.
